The Mine Health and Safety Council (MHSC) was established in terms of the Mine Health and Safety Act (MHSA) to advise the Minister of Minerals and Energy on health and safety at mines, on research programmes and the review of regulations pertaining to mine health and safety.The MHSC is listed as a Public Entity (Schedule 3A) according to the PFMA, and in terms of government funding received for administrative purposes, as legislated by the Mine Health and Safety Act.he MHSC hereby invites applications from suitable qualified persons wishing to serve on its Information Communication Technology Steering Committee (ICTSC).
